TAMPA, Fla. (WFLA) — As the holiday season approaches, AAA anticipates a record-breaking number of travelers this year, with end-of-year holiday travel set to reach unprecedented levels.

AAA projects that 122 million Americans will be hitting the road or taking to the skies over the Christmas and New Year’s holidays.

In Florida alone, approximately 7.5 million residents are expected to travel during this festive period. AAA estimates that 6.7 million of these travelers will be taking to the highways to reach their holiday destinations.

Mark Jenkins, a spokesperson for AAA, advises that now is an ideal time to fill up your gas tank and embark on that long-awaited road trip.
